Ordinals
beta
Address 34uPY9ioDn1qxE7E9pfaYsPFUVMedoSYTQ
sat balance
75121
outputs
261d5d63ec7ce2bc6c600e5b77110dbcdfc22b92b2703c051e57781d4392c10d:3